Git 设置 Notepad++ 作为 Git 的 diff 工具

Git 设置 Notepad++ 作为 Git 的 diff 工具

在本文中,我们将介绍如何将 Notepad++ 设置为 Git 上的 diff 工具。Git 是一款流行的版本控制系统,它可以用于跟踪和管理软件开发项目的变更。作为软件开发人员,我们经常需要比较代码文件之间的差异,以便理解并管理变更。Notepad++ 是一款强大的文本编辑器,它提供了丰富的功能,适合于编写和修改代码文件。将 Notepad++ 设置为 Git 的 diff 工具,将为我们提供更好的代码比较体验。

阅读更多:Git 教程

步骤 1:检查 Notepad++ 是否已安装

首先,我们需要确保 Notepad++ 已在我们的计算机上安装。我们可以在 Notepad++ 的官方网站(https://notepad-plus-plus.org/downloads/)上下载并安装最新版本的 Notepad++。

步骤 2:配置 Git

接下来,我们需要在 Git 中配置使用 Notepad++ 作为 diff 工具。我们可以通过 Git Bash 或命令行执行以下命令来配置 Git:

git config --global diff.tool notepad++
git config --global difftool.notepad++.cmd 'npp -multiInst -nosession (cd(dirname "LOCAL") && pwd -W)(cd (dirname "REMOTE") && pwd -W)'
Bash

这些命令会将 Notepad++ 设置为全局的 diff 工具,并配置所需的参数。

步骤 3:使用 Notepad++ 比较差异

一旦完成配置,我们可以开始使用 Notepad++ 来比较 Git 中的差异。下面是一些示例命令和用法:

  • 比较当前工作目录下的文件差异:
git difftool fileName
Bash

这将打开 Notepad++,在左侧显示本地版本的文件,右侧显示远程版本的文件。我们可以根据需要进行修改并保存。

  • 比较提交之间的差异:
git difftool commitHash1 commitHash2
Bash

这将打开 Notepad++,显示两个提交之间的差异。我们可以方便地浏览并查看差异。

  • 比较分支之间的差异:
git difftool branchName1 branchName2
Bash

这将打开 Notepad++,显示两个分支之间的差异。我们可以根据需要进行代码合并和处理。

步骤 4:自定义 Notepad++ 的差异显示

Notepad++ 提供了一些自定义选项,以便更好地显示差异。我们可以在 Notepad++ 的“设置”菜单中找到这些选项。例如,我们可以更改差异行的背景颜色、文本颜色等。

总结

通过将 Notepad++ 设置为 Git 的 diff 工具,我们可以方便地比较代码文件之间的差异。这提供了更好的代码比较体验,并帮助我们更好地理解和管理代码变更。这篇文章介绍了将 Notepad++ 设置为 Git 的 diff 工具的步骤,并提供了一些示例用法。希望这些信息对你有所帮助!

Python教程

Java教程

Web教程

数据库教程

图形图像教程

大数据教程

开发工具教程

计算机教程

登录

注册